Local Review: Riley – The Cat of Nine Tails: Part One

What do you get when you combine musical technicality with loud sing-a-long choruses? Well, it would sound a little bit like Riley, a local Dayton band consisting of Eric Bluebaum, Joey Kirby, Colin Pauley, and Chris Warman. Although most of the guys have played together before, the four piece regrouped and refocused in February 2012, […]

WSU Symphony Orchestra Spring Concert

The WSU Symphony Orchestra, which started out as the University/Community Orchestra, brings musicians from the community and students together. Some members are beginners while others have been playing for many years. The WSU Symphony Orchestra is made up of a full orchestra. Do you know the Muffin Man?

For the past two years, Craig Kigar, the WSU Hot Dog Man, has been selling hot dogs, donuts, coffee and other foods and drinks for students on the go.
